Description[?]:
The binding force between all cornerstones of rule is a nation of peaceful, open minded and free people. Where your neighbour is your brother and nobody's voice is unheard. ”Together, we are strong” The Central Liberation Party of Hutori was founded in November 4777. Political Position: Left of Center The Central Liberation Party of Hutori is founded on 3 guiding principles. 1. The people of Hutori are Hutori. Government and state should exist only to serve and uphold their livelihoods, rights and communities. 2. The Economy of Hutori works best when it works for the people. By bringing the peoples interests to the centre of all fiscal decision making, no private entity can be allowed to profit from the strength of our solidarity and labour. 3. For Economy and Community to prosper, we must be open to a culture of progression and learning. It is important that as Hutorians we remember and understand our nations identity, whilst also being open and engaged with ways of moving forward to better the Commonwealth of Hutori and it's citizens. |
